We have several auctions of interest for you tonight, all from Ebay seller anglo. We are delving into the weird and wonderful Japanese released Transformers, who are more than capable of taking a Unicron-sized bite out of your bank balance!

The first auction that caught my eye is this Headmaster, Trizer. Trizer was one of six replacement Headmaster heads, released in Japan only in 1987. The idea behind them was that they could be switched between the main released Headmasters, and used as replacements if you lost the original head (and I'm sure most of us, and one time or another, owned a "Headless master"!) All six of the heads rarely turn up on Ebay, and that is why Trizer here is the first part of this feature!

Moving from one rarity to another, we have Guard City, who was one of the very last items released in the Generation 1 line, in Japan in 1992. He's a redeco of Generation 1's Defensor, and the set is very rarely seen - and extremely rarely seen in a box in near pristine condition like this one! Just try not to look at the price, trust me on that.

This Beastformers boxed set is also noteworthy. These ten Battle Beasts are among those who actually appeared in the Japanese Headmasters series, and includes the "Burstsun" variant of the White Lion, only available in this set.

Other auctions of interest include the huge Grand Maximus, Big Powered giftset of Dai Atlas, Sonic Bomber and Roadfire, plus Transformers Victory's Star Saber and Victory Leo. Each of these are not uncommon, but worth mentioning for being items that have rarely if ever been removed from the styrofoam, and having unapplied stickers. These are some of the very best examples of Japanese Transformers, in what is possibly the best condition available (excepting Dai Atlas' yellowing). Unfortunately the prices do reflect this, but check them out to see some of the items that appear on many fan's collection grail lists.
